Initial D Character Cellphone Straps
Initial D cellphone straps are usually of the cars, but these are of the characters! These cute, chibi character cellphone straps were bought by Cat while visiting China. It is a set with Itsuki, Kenta, Keisuke, Takumi, and Ryosuke. |

FD3S RX-7 and FC3S RX-7 Models Kevin bought the FD, and Cat bought the FC. Instead of coming with figurines of the characters, these 2 actually come with cardboard cutouts located on the side of the box: Keisuke cutout | Ryosuke cutout There are more cutouts inside the box too. (Both models come with the same cutouts inside.) The FC also comes with extra decals to place on the car. |

Doujinshi: Warp Drive
(Doujinshi = published fan-made comics) Owned by Cat, this one is a hilarious gag doujinshi featuring stories of Project D, including a perverted Ryosuke, an insane Takumi, and a freaked out Keisuke. |

Doujinshi: Electric Man and Cutie Costume Man
This is another of Cat's doujinshis. As silly as the title sounds, it's actually not a gag one. However, it is kind of weird because it has Ryosuke and Keisuke but does not involve any racing. Instead, it's a serious doujinshi, and... they're armed with guns...? |

Live Action Doujinshi
This is just... a really weird doujinshi, also owned by Cat. Instead of using the Initial D characters, the artist drew in the Live Action actors. Also, the cars are wrong and the storyline doesn't really follow the Anime nor live action. |
